On 15 jul, 15:05, Matthew Caron wrote:
It seems that my case is somewhat different. My Trac installation is
under the same directory (/usr/lib/python2.5/site-packages), but my
egg is a file, not a directory. I did try to unzip it, update the
messages.mo file and replace the original egg
I think... ;-)
Worked like a charm, didn't even had to restart the server :)
Thank you very much!
I think what happens is that when it's an .egg file, it presumes
everything is already byte-compiled. If it's a .egg directory, it checks
for updated source and byte-compiles it if necessary.

The problem was two things:
The style.css file must be in the htdocs directory, not the template
directory. And, when putting it there, one's luck is much better if they
actually call the file style.css (the name in the site.html file),
rather than something like, oh, I don't know, site.css.
